
Warriors' Trade Deadline: Kuminga, Green, Leonard
About this episode
The Golden State Warriors made waves during the February trade deadline, with Jonathan Kuminga demanding a trade and the team exploring big moves around Stephen Curry. Draymond Green was also involved in talks, potentially heading to the Milwaukee Bucks for Giannis Antetokounmpo. Despite no blockbuster deals materializing, the Warriors reached out to Kawhi Leonard, and eyes are now on the summer for potential moves to reload the team.
